1. The Mnemonic: SOHCAHTOA
This acronym helps you remember which sides of a right-angled triangle correspond to Sine, Cosine, and Tangent relative to a specific angle $\theta$.
* O = Opposite side (the side across from the angle)
* A = Adjacent side (the side next to the angle, but not the hypotenuse)
* H = Hypotenuse (the longest side, opposite the right angle)

2. The Three Ratios

* SOH (Sine)
* Formula: $\sin(\theta) = \frac{\text{Opposite}}{\text{Hypotenuse}}$
* Triangle Aid: To find Opposite, multiply $\sin(\theta) \times H$. To find Hypotenuse, divide $O / \sin(\theta)$.

* CAH (Cosine)
* Formula: $\cos(\theta) = \frac{\text{Adjacent}}{\text{Hypotenuse}}$
* Triangle Aid: To find Adjacent, multiply $\cos(\theta) \times H$. To find Hypotenuse, divide $A / \cos(\theta)$.

* TOA (Tangent)
* Formula: $\tan(\theta) = \frac{\text{Opposite}}{\text{Adjacent}}$
* Triangle Aid: To find Opposite, multiply $\tan(\theta) \times A$. To find Adjacent, divide $O / \tan(\theta)$.
